看板 Grad-ProbAsk 關於我們 聯絡資訊
Consider the following C++ class: class Node { int n; int key[2]; Node *left, *middle, *right; bool leaf }; Which of the following data structure is probably defined? (A) Binary Search Tree (B) AVL Tree (C) B-Tree (D) Binomial Heap (E) Fibonacci Heap. 不太確定答案~~ 幫我解答一下 謝謝 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 61.216.8.200
crazykk:個人認為是C 03/19 20:06
crazykk:Node *left, *middle, *right; 代表3個指標(即degree) 03/19 20:07
crazykk:而int key[2]; 代表一個node最多可以放兩個key 03/19 20:07
crazykk:從以上兩點來看,就是2-3tree,即B tree 03/19 20:08
flyguava:喔喔 我沒想到key.. 謝謝了^^ 03/19 20:12
sa074463:我也覺得是C 03/19 20:14
flyguava:也謝謝樓上 03/19 20:27
newton510:c +1 理由同上 03/19 20:37